– BODYROOF HEADLINING (Wagon)
INSTALLATION
1. w/ Curtain Shield Airbag:
INSTALL CURTAIN SHIELD AIRBAG
In order shown in the illustration, install the deployment section
of the curtain shield airbag with the bolts and grommet.
Torque: 9.8 N·m (100 kgf·cm, 7 ift·lbf)
2. INSTALL ROOF HEAD LINING
Install the 5 clips and roof headlining.
3. INSTALL THESE PARTS:
(a) w/ Sliding Roof:
Install the sliding roof opening trim.
(b) Install the room light.
(c) Install the sun visors and holders.
(d) Install the assist grips.
4. INSTALL ROOF SIDE INNER GARNISH
Install the roof side inner garnish with the bolt and screw.
5. INSTALL DECK TRIM SIDE BOARD
(a) Install the deck trim side board with the clip.
(b) Install the rear seat outer belt floor anchor bolt.
Torque: 42 N·m (430 kgf·cm, 31 ft·lbf)
6. INSTALL DECK SIDE TRIM COVER
Install the deck side trim cover.

– AIR CONDITIONINGDRIVE BELT (1CD–FTV)
AC–3
INSTALLATION
INSTALL DRIVE BELT
(a) Tighten the idle pulley lock nut temporarily.
Torque: 2.5 N·m (25 kgf·cm, 22 in.·lbf)
(b) Install the drive belt.
(c) Using a adjusting bolt, adjust drive belt tension.
Drive belt tension:
New belt: 520 – 755 N (53 – 77 kgf)
Used belt: 196 – 392 N (20 – 40 kgf)
(d) Tighten the idle pulley lock nut at regular torque.
Torque: 39 N·m (390 kgf·cm, 29 ft·lbf)

– AIR CONDITIONINGREFRIGERANT LINE
REPLACEMENT
1. DISCHARGE REFRIGERANT FROM REFRIGERATION SYSTEM
2. REPLACE FAULTY TUBE OR HOSE
NOTICE:
Cap the open fittings immediately to keep moisture or dirt out of the system.
3. TIGHTEN JOINT OF BOLT OR NUT AT SPECIFIED TORQUE
NOTICE:
Connections should not be torqued tighter than the specified torque.
Part tightenedN·mkgf·cmft·lbf
Compressor x Discharge hose101007
Compressor x Suction hose101007
Condenser x Discharge hose101007
Condenser x Liquid tube101007
Liquid line (Block joint)101007
Suction line (Piping joint)3233024
4. EVACUATE AIR FROM REFRIGERATION SYSTEM AND CHARGE SYSTEM WITH REFRIGERANT
Specified amount: 450 50 g (15.87 1.76 oz.)
5. INSPECT FOR LEAKAGE OF REFRIGERANT
Using a gas leak detector, check for leakage of refrigerant.
6. INSPECT AIR CONDITIONING OPERATION

– AIR CONDITIONINGELECTRICAL TYPE POWER HEATER
INSPECTION
1. DRAIN ENGINE COOLANT
2. REMOVE AIR CLEANER ASSEMBLY
3. REMOVE GLOW PLUGS
(a) Remove the glow plug cap.
(b) Remove the 3 bolts.
(c) Remove the glow plug plate.
(d) Remove the glow plug stay.
(e) Remove the 3 glow plugs.
4. INSPECT GLOW PLUGS
Using an ohmmeter, check that there is continuity between the
glow plug terminal and ground.
Standard resistance at 20C (68F):
Approx. 0.22 Ω
If there is continuity, replace the glow plug.
Torque: 13 N·m (130 kgf·cm, 9 ft·lbf)
5. REINSTALL GLOW PLUGS
(a) Install the 3 glow plugs.
(b) Install the glow plug stay.
(c) Install the glow plug plate.
(d) Install the 3 bolts.
(e) Install the glow plug cap.
6. REINSTALL AIR CLEANER ASSEMBLY
7. FILL ENGINE COOLANT

– AIR CONDITIONINGCOMPRESSOR AND MAGNETIC CLUTCH (1CD–FTV)
INSTALLATION
1. INSTALL COMPRESSOR
(a) Install the compressor with the 3 bolts.
Torque: 25 N·m (250 kgf·cm, 18 ft·lbf)
(b) Connect the connector.
2. CONNECT DISCHARGE AND SUCTION HOSES
Connect the both hoses with the 2 bolts.
Torque: 10 N·m (100 kgf·cm, 7 ft·lbf)
CAUTION:
Hoses should be connected immediately after the caps
have removed.
HINT:
Lubricate 2 new O–rings with compressor oil and install the
hoses.
3. INSTALL RESERVOIR TANK
(a) Connect the reservoir tank with the 2 bolts.
(b) Connect the lower hose.
(c) Install the upper hose.
4. REFILL ENGINE COOLANT
5. INSTALL AND CHECK DRIVE BELT
(See page AC–3)
6. INSTALL ENGINE UNDER COVER RH
7. CONNECT NEGATIVE (–) TERMINAL CABLE TO BAT-
TERY
8. EVACUATE AIR IN REFRIGERATION SYSTEM AND
CHARGE WITH REFRIGERANT
Specified amount: 450 50 g (15.87 1.76 oz.)
9. INSPECT FOR LEAKAGE OF REFRIGERANT
Using a gas leak detector, check the tightening torque at the
joints.
10. INSPECT A/C OPERATION
